Proton

The documentation is available here

Proton is an easily customizable html5 particle engine including six different types of renderers.
Check out examples at http://a-jie.github.io/Proton/

Features

  • Six kinds of renderers
    • canvas
    • dom
    • webgl
    • easeljs
    • pixel
    • pixijs
  • Create cool effects like the demo of 71squared's ParticleDesigner in 10 lines of code.
  • Integratable into any game engine
  • Veriety of behaviors
  • Three kinds of emitters which can simulate many different physical effects

Installation

Install using npm

anix

npm install proton-js --save
... 
import Proton from 'proton-js';

Include in html

<script type="text/javascript" src="js/proton.min.js"></script> 

Usage

var proton = new Proton();
var emitter = new Proton.Emitter();

//set Rate
emitter.rate = new Proton.Rate(Proton.getSpan(10, 20), 0.1);

//add Initialize
emitter.addInitialize(new Proton.Radius(1, 12));
emitter.addInitialize(new Proton.Life(2, 4));
emitter.addInitialize(new Proton.Velocity(3, Proton.getSpan(0, 360), 'polar'));

//add Behaviour
emitter.addBehaviour(new Proton.Color('ff0000', 'random'));
emitter.addBehaviour(new Proton.Alpha(1, 0));

//set emitter position
emitter.p.x = canvas.width / 2;
emitter.p.y = canvas.height / 2;
emitter.emit();

//add emitter to the proton
proton.addEmitter(emitter);

// add canvas renderer
var renderer = new Proton.Renderer('canvas', proton, canvas);
renderer.start();

//use Euler integration calculation is more accurate (default false)
Proton.USE_CLOCK = false or true;

Building Proton

Node is a dependency, use terminal to install it with with:
git clone git://github.com/a-jie/Proton.git

Then navigate to the build directory by running:

cd ./build
node build.js

Or use npm script

npm run build
